Sora is participating in research similar to research presented in the text. He has been exposed to the virus that causes the co

mmon cold and he has been given six assignments to be completed in the next two days. If his results replicate the previous research findings reported in your text, what will happen to Sora?
Social Studies
1 answer:
Aleks [24]4 years ago
3 0

This question is missing the options. I've found the complete question online. It is as follows:

If his results replicate the previous research findings reported in your text, what will happen to Sora?

a. He will complete the assignments on time and not get sick.

b. He will get sick.

c. He will quit the research.

d. He will be too stressed out to sleep.

Answer:

The correct answer is letter b. He will get sick.

Explanation:

Sora will be exposed to the virus that causes the common cold. Then, he will be asked to complete six assignments in only two days.<u> Such a difficult task will cause Sora to be stressed and, as we know, stress makes our immune system weaker, among other things. With his immune system weakened, Sora will get sick.</u> If, however, he had been exposed to the virus and then his immune systems had not been affected by stress, he wouldn't necessarily get sick.
